In a lush organic garden, several local herbs and wild vegetables are quietly stealing the spotlight. One of them is moringa (Moringa oleifera), known locally in some areas as pucuk kelor. Often called a “superfood tree,” its leaves are widely discussed for their nutrient density and traditional wellness uses.

🌱 The “Hidden Gems” of Local Ulam
Among the greenery, there’s also tenggek burung, a unique leafy plant that has caught the attention of researchers for years. Known for its distinctive three-leaf pattern, it has been studied for its antioxidant properties and potential health-related compounds.
Some even describe it as a plant that has been explored in academic research for its bioactive potential — including laboratory studies looking into how natural plant compounds interact with cell behavior.
Then there are other local favourites:
- 🌿 Serai kayu (wild lemongrass variety) — commonly used in traditional dishes like nasi kerabu for its aromatic kick
- 🌿 Beluntas — another traditional herb known in local food culture
- 🌿 Wild eggplant varieties — often eaten as ulam (raw salad-style vegetables) after being boiled or blanched
- 🌿 Organic sawi harvested carefully, keeping only the best leaves while natural pest control methods are used
It’s not just gardening — it’s a mix of heritage farming, organic living, and traditional knowledge passed through generations.
